Pakistan Telecommunication Authority (PTA) Chairman Hafeezur Naeem has revealed alarming details about the country’s data security, warning that Pakistan’s entire data is stored on foreign servers and is vulnerable to theft. The disclosure came during a meeting of the Senate Standing Committee on Information Technology on Friday.

The PTA chief confirmed that even his own SIM card data has been available on the dark web since 2022. He further stated that the personal information of citizens who applied for Hajj has also been stolen and is now being circulated online. He stressed that Pakistan urgently needs a national data centre to protect sensitive information from cyber theft. Ongoing investigations by the Ministry of Interior and the National Cyber Crime Investigation Agency are trying to trace the source of the breaches.

Senator Afnanullah warned the committee that data theft has turned into a multi-billion-rupee industry. He accused powerful groups of blocking the passage of the Data Protection Bill to protect their interests. Committee chairperson Senator Palwasha Khan also raised concerns about the future of “Digital Pakistan” under such conditions. She revealed that her own personal data may have been compromised, sharing that she received a call from a private number asking her to pay a credit card bill. She urged the government to take immediate action, pass the bill, and hold accountable those resisting it.

The PTA chairman also advised parliamentarians and the public to be cautious about accepting mobile phones as gifts, warning that such devices could contain hidden surveillance bugs capable of recording calls and accessing private apps like WhatsApp.

Officials from the Ministry of IT assured the committee that a Data Protection Bill has already been drafted. They also said an alternative to WhatsApp is being developed, with consultations and security clearance currently in progress.
